Output 128bb5d56da8d5254ae511c36b66d428eee99e45965f8ac126d7932bc69e3d26:50

value
22991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2bcef1e82f5290a4d56b55e5c9434aff7fc1162 OP_EQUAL
address
3LuJACN2R7PvqhBJ1ekd4CVECerBJ2Bf8x
transaction
128bb5d56da8d5254ae511c36b66d428eee99e45965f8ac126d7932bc69e3d26
spent
true